Cubs’ Epstein fires two in front office
CHICAGO (MCT) — Cubs President Theo Epstein continued his front office makeover Wednesday, firing player personnel vice president Oneri Fleita and information manager Chuck Wasserstrom.
Baseball operations director Scott Nelson was offered a lesser role in the organization, while stats manager Ari Kaplan will stay on as a consultant after his job was eliminated.
